During the recent cron drift investigation on the Tindervale platform, we found that plugins publishing on stale clocks produced schedules offset by several minutes. Before deploying your plugin, sync against the canonical timeserver and confirm your manifest's cron expressions evaluate identically on the staging scheduler. Plugins that pass the drift check must then be signed, or the registry will quarantine them. Once your timing check passes, sign the plugin bundle using the key that follows.

deploy key for kahof-tadup: bky4_rRMZ

## Onboarding: The Fennelworth Schema Registry

All events published to the Fennelworth bus must have a schema registered first. Producers fetch schemas by subject name; the registry enforces backward compatibility on every new version. Breaking changes require a new subject. Local development uses the sandbox registry, which mirrors production nightly. To publish schemas from CI, the pipeline signs each registration request using the key shown below.

release key, fahaf-bajof: bky3_Xam

## Formula sandbox tuning

User-supplied formulas in Gridmoor execute inside a restricted interpreter with hard ceilings on time, memory, and call depth. Reviewers should confirm any change to these ceilings is justified in the PR description, since raising them widens the abuse surface. Defaults were chosen from production traces. The current limits are as follows.

limits module of tafog-fawip:
WEIGHTS = {
    "julix": 57,
    "lamys": 992,
    "kasvan": 209,
    "quenok": 750,
    "alddor": 259,
    "oliath": 1009,
    "wenix": 815,
}

Re: Retirement of the Stonebriar product line

Stonebriar sales have declined for five consecutive quarters and support costs now exceed contribution margin. The retirement plan is staged: new orders close end of Q2, existing contracts honoured through their terms, and spares stocked for twenty-four months. Sales leads should steer prospects toward the Ashgrove range; migration incentives are already approved. Customer comms are drafted and awaiting legal sign-off. The forward strategy behind this decision is set out in the note below.

confidential, yafog-hagug: Gross margin on Druix came in at 10 percent against a plan of 15 percent. Only 5 of the 80 pilot accounts renewed Druix, so a churn review is set for October 1.